Perodua Bezza:
The Perodua Bezza is a city car produced by Malaysian automobile manufacturer Perodua. It was launched on 21 July 2016 as Perodua's first sedan car, and a complement to the Axia hatchback.
The Bezza is based on the Axia's platform, and is powered by the latter's 1. 0-litre engine, in addition to a new 1. 3-litre plant. The Bezza is Perodua's first major in-house design. Perodua leads the styling and development of the Bezza's upper body structure, with technical support from Daihatsu. The Bezza is the second model to debut from Perodua's all-new factory in Serendah, Selangor....(Read more on Wikipedia)

Pros and Cons:
Pros:
- • Exceptional fuel efficiency across all variants
- • Class-leading boot space (508L) for a compact sedan
- • Highly affordable purchase price and low running costs
- • Proven Perodua reliability and extensive service network
- • Compact dimensions make it easy to maneuver and park in urban environments
Cons:
- • Engines, especially the 1.0L automatic, can feel underpowered for highway driving
- • Interior materials are basic, reflecting its budget-friendly positioning
- • Limited advanced safety and convenience features compared to higher segments
- • Ride comfort can be firm over rougher surfaces
- • Noise insulation is average, with noticeable engine and road noise at higher speeds
